Basic Concepts of Fuel Pumps

A fuel pump is a device that moves fuel from the fuel tank to the engine. It functions within an engine system by maintaining the required fuel pressure for efficient combustion. There are different types of fuel pumps, including mechanical, electric, and high-pressure pumps, each suited to specific applications and engine requirements 1.

Role of Part 30955577101 Fuel Pump in Engine Systems

The part 30955577101 Fuel Pump is an essential component in the fuel delivery system of an engine. Its primary function is to draw fuel from the fuel tank and deliver it to the engine’s fuel injectors or carburetor at the required pressure and flow rate.

Integration with Fuel System Components

  1. Fuel Tank: The fuel pump is typically located inside the fuel tank. It draws fuel from the tank and begins the process of pressurizing it for delivery to the engine.
  2. Fuel Lines: Once the fuel is drawn from the tank, it travels through fuel lines. These lines connect the fuel pump to the fuel filter and subsequently to the fuel injectors or carburetor. The pump ensures a consistent flow of fuel through these lines.
  3. Fuel Filter: Before the fuel reaches the engine, it passes through a fuel filter. The fuel pump provides the necessary pressure to push the fuel through the filter, ensuring that any contaminants are removed.
  4. Fuel Injectors: In modern engines equipped with fuel injection systems, the fuel pump delivers pressurized fuel to the fuel injectors. The injectors then spray the fuel into the combustion chambers in a finely atomized state, optimizing combustion efficiency.
  5. Carburetor: In older engines or those designed with carburetors, the fuel pump supplies fuel to the carburetor. The carburetor mixes the fuel with air before it enters the combustion chamber.
  6. Fuel Pressure Regulator: The fuel pump works in conjunction with the fuel pressure regulator to maintain a consistent fuel pressure. This regulator ensures that the fuel injectors or carburetor receive the correct amount of fuel, regardless of engine load or speed.
  7. Engine Control Unit (ECU): In many modern vehicles, the ECU monitors the fuel system and can adjust the fuel pump’s operation to optimize performance and fuel efficiency. Sensors provide feedback to the ECU, allowing it to make real-time adjustments.
  8. Return Line: Some fuel systems include a return line that sends excess fuel back to the tank. The fuel pump must generate enough pressure to overcome the resistance in this return line, ensuring that the fuel injectors or carburetor always receive the correct fuel pressure.
